According to recent reports from Nikkei Asia, Japan's employment rate for new university graduates has climbed to near-record levels. The latest available data suggests that the rate is among the highest in decades, driven by strong demand from employers across various sectors. However, the rise of AI and automation technologies looms as a potential disruptor. Companies are increasingly adopting AI-driven processes, which could alter the hiring landscape for fresh graduates. The report highlights that while current employment figures are robust, the long-term impact of AI on job roles remains uncertain. Labor shortages in certain industries may be temporarily masking the structural shifts that AI could bring, and the near-record rate might not fully reflect future hiring dynamics. The near-record rate indicates that Japanese companies are currently eager to recruit new talent, possibly due to labor shortages. However, the integration of AI could lead to job displacement in certain industries, particularly in administrative and routine tasks. This may prompt a shift in the skills demanded by employers. The education system and job training programs may need to adapt to prepare graduates for an AI-augmented workforce. The looming presence of AI suggests that the current high employment rate might not be sustainable if automation accelerates. Sectors such as finance, retail, and manufacturing are likely to be most affected by AI-driven changes, potentially altering the job market structure for new graduates. From an investment perspective, the situation presents both opportunities and risks. Investors may consider companies that are leaders in AI adoption, as they could benefit from increased efficiency. Conversely, firms heavily reliant on low-skilled labor could face margin pressures. The labor market dynamics in Japan may influence consumer spending and economic growth. Regulators and policymakers might introduce measures to mitigate job displacement, such as reskilling initiatives. Overall, while the employment outlook for new graduates appears favorable in the short term, the AI factor warrants cautious monitoring for long-term implications. The interplay between demographic trends and technological disruption will likely shape Japan's labor market trajectory in the coming years.
